The Problems Of Agronomic Assistance To The Population Interrogated To Turkestan By The Tsarist Russian Federation
Khusniddin Juraev , Researcher At Fergana State University, UzbekistanAbstract
This article examines the policy of resettlement of Tsarist Russia to Turkestan, its military-political
and socio-economic goals, the Russian settlements established in the country, the life of the
displaced population, their lifestyle, occupations, agronomic assistance.
